Game Time: An Educated Guess
First things first, let’s get the basics out of the way. The Philadelphia Eagles typically play their games on Sunday afternoons, but game times can vary, and that’s part of what makes the NFL fun and slightly maddening! I’ve learned to keep an eye on the schedule every week, usually on one of those delightful sports apps. Timing can change based on if it’s a prime-time game, a late-afternoon slot, or — heaven forbid — a Thursday night matchup.
